Description
Job Summary: The Adjuster position ensures that Gibson delivers a quality product by safely handling all instruments and getting them ready to be sent to a customer. This role will inspect and set up guitars to Gibson specifications.   Essential Functions: * Learn and execute standard operating procedures. * Successfully cross train in all Final Assembly roles. * Must be able to tune and set up a Gibson to set specifications. * Final quality check before the product leaves the site.  * 95% pass rate based on production requirements. * Understands and meets quality standards (Specs.) * Maintains product flow at appropriate rate. * Adheres to department protocols (5S and Safety.)   Required Skills/Abilities: * Strong attention to detail.  * Outstanding time management skillset with the ability to prioritize without direct supervision.  * Teamwork and project management skills. * Solutions oriented approach to challenges/issues. * 3-5 years guitar playing experience. * Basic guitar maintenance knowledge - changing strings, string height adjustments, ability to evaluate acceptable instrument playability and structural soundness, etc.   Education and Experience: * Results oriented and driven, with a track record for delivering to plan. * Must be 18 years of age or older.   Physical Demands: * Must be able to stand all day and lift guitars throughout the day.   The company’s Job Descriptions are not intended to be a complete detailed account of all expected/anticipated activities.
